Malawi and fellow SADC member states have adopted a crucial report on the political situation in Madagascar, while approving the deployment of a regional goodwill mission to the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) to bolster peace and stability.
These decisions were finalised on Monday during an Extraordinary Summit of the Southern African Development Community (SADC) Organ Troika on Politics, Defence, and Security Cooperation, which was hosted virtually by Malawi.
